Chazberg Posted December 18, 2007 Share Posted December 18, 2007 This has really been bugging me all season-has anyone else noticed how much the "9" on Romo's jersey looks like an "8"? The Cowboys use that extremely thick block font, and the bottom part of the 9 comes up so far it almost touches the top. I even remember seeing a caption in a SI issue earlier this year that referred to "Romo (8)". This is just further reason the 'Boys need to go back to the throwback number font full time, which is so much easier to read. At least nobody's gonna confuse him with Aikman after their last game... Uhh... check out the original post and skyy1's post above, and you'll see the comparisons. There are several fonts (Cowboys, Dolphins, Vikings, as shown in the examples) where the bottom left serif comes up so high that it almost touches the middle bar of the 9, thus making it look like an 8 (I actually first noticed this problem on my daughter's soccer uniforms). With the Saints' font, on the other hand, there is enough space between the bottom left serif and the middle bar that you can actually tell it's a 9.
